Within the last few weeks I've realized that my website is getting plenty of spam. Not just a few spam comments in some places but a lot of the damn stuff. The fact is reported by Google Analytics the website appears to acquire more spam comments than actual site visitors. I still have not got around to activating my Askimet configurations yet to prevent the spam remarks. Now having looked around a handful of black hat forums I noticed that this system is fairly popular. I figured I'd perform a little test!

So out comes my copy of Scrapebox and I harvested some Wordpress blogs. Scrapebox by the way can be great for finding blogs related to your niche if used in a white hat manner, which will be covered once i start to put up some tools for Search engine optimization Reviews. Anyway I thought I'd try a little experiment just to find out if spamming works or not. To be honest anyone with blog with any real traffic would always decline them anyway. However some people don't know how to use Wordpress blogs effectively too, me included.

After harvesting some (very few) I let Scrapebox rip and off it went auto commenting on blogs (sorry incidentally if you were one of these). Within an hour I got an email from one of the people which i had spammed and he informed me that 90% of those who left comments gave an incorrect email. That's because they don't want you to email them back and make a complaint! I did check to see how many of these links did actually get okayed but it was very few indeed.

The truth is if you have a spam comment approved then it is gonna be by a website that generates little or no interest and would definitely have very little or no page ranking. If the link did get approval then the it's likely that the page has or will be spammed to death anyway. You would need to make a huge quantity of of them to make any real difference in search engine positions as well as risk Google putting your website in the dreaded 'Sandbox'. So having used your time harvesting URL's to discover prospective spamming victims, wasting more time whist the spamming software does it's work and checking to determine if any of the comment stuck would it have been worth the time in the first place.

There will probably be a few people who come on here and comment to state that it does work if it is implemented correctly but for the time wasted would not it be easier to find a few webpage's with high page ranking and write a good comment related to their posts.

At the end of the day it doesn't matter how many backlinks you've got if the ones you do have are from high quality - high page ranking and related websites as these are worth much more and so are almost certainly going to attract referrals too.
